## Scanline Integration — Environments

The Scanline barcode scanner integration runs in three environments: sandbox, staging, and production, each pointing at a separate Korvath decoding backend. Support team members should reproduce customer issues in staging first, since sandbox uses synthetic barcode payloads that can mask encoding bugs. Production access is read-only for support accounts. The staging environment's configuration values are listed below.

config for yajep-tafof:
[rusath]
team = julmir
access_code = ac_fe37fd
host = rusath.novactech.test
port = 8000
owner = pelmir.weneth
peer = oliwyn.olvarqdyn.internal

## Deployment

PortionWise (the recipe-scaling calculator) ships as a single container. Build with the standard Makefile target, push to the Brindlehurst registry, then bump the image tag in the deploy repo. Staging rolls automatically; production requires approval from whoever is on rotation. No database — all scaling math is stateless, so rollbacks are just a tag revert. Health checks hit /ready. Before your first deploy, confirm your environment matches the values below.

deployment values, tafog-kagap:
wenath:
  pin: 4244
  metrics_host: metrics.wenath.lumicsys.internal
  tenant: istix
  seal: seal_10585894

## Build Provenance: Leaked FD Hunt

During the Quillhaven 4.2 rollout, the Marlet build agents began exhausting file descriptors mid-compile. We traced it to a sandbox wrapper that duplicated pipes into child processes without close-on-exec flags. Support should know: affected artifacts were rebuilt on the Torvane pool after the fix landed, so checksums changed even though sources did not. If a customer reports a hash mismatch, verify they pulled the rebuilt artifact. The rebuilt release is identified by the token below.

build token for kagaf-hahof: htk14_9d3d4d26d7d8de